终端屏幕操作脚本与功能解析
在终端操作的领域中,有许多实用的脚本和功能可以帮助我们更高效地进行屏幕显示和文本处理。本文将详细介绍一些常见的终端屏幕操作脚本及其功能。
1. PostScript 转换脚本
首先,有将填字游戏网格转换为 PostScript 的脚本。这个脚本生成的是基础的 PostScript 程序,虽然它可能不包含某些 PostScript 解释器期望的所有文档结构约定,但对于 Ghostscript 和 PostScript 打印机的解释器来说已经足够完整。不过,它主要设计用于处理标准的 7 位 ASCII 字符集,不过也可以进行修改以支持更多字符。
row=$(( $row + 1 ))
lastrow=$puzrow
done
echo "showpage"
} > "$outfile"
## If $convert is set, do the appropriate conversion
case $convert in
*epsi) ps2epsi "$puzfile" ;;
*?*) convert -trim "$outfile" "${outfile%.ps}.${convert#.}" ;;
esac
除了这个脚本,还有用于打印国际象棋位置的脚本,包括单个棋谱图(通常用于转换为 PNG 图像)和包含多个棋谱图的页面,方便分发给国际象棋学生。而且,更多时候会使用文本编辑器编写 PostScript 程序,并打开 Ghostview 窗口来显示结果,每次保存文件时窗口都会更新。
超级会员免费看
订阅专栏 解锁全文
1万+

被折叠的 条评论
为什么被折叠?



